At a glance

The Blackout Gold Lite is way more affordable at CA$180 and gives you a much wider curve selection with five blade options versus three. The Code Encrypt Pro shaves off a few extra grams and brings a more refined carbon construction, but you're paying CA$80 more for those gains.

Pick the HockeyStickMan Pro Blackout Gold Lite

  • Budget matters and you want to keep CA$80 in your pocket
  • You want more curve options, especially W03 or W28 which Sherwood doesn't offer
  • You shoot more than you stickhandle and don't need premium blade dampening

Pick the Sherwood Code Encrypt Pro

  • You prioritize puck feel and want the VR-92 blade dampening for passes and dekes
  • You prefer a round shaft shape and want a confirmed fit in hand
  • You want a stick with more documented construction details and a broader flex range including a 95 flex option
